@augur  The point of sale has to take place in Europe on dealers margin or it attracts 20%VAT under UK rules.  If gs.be were to officially become involved with BB then that would imply that they had a UK branch in effect which would mean an additional 20% VAT.  I think for normal things it works out well with BB acting like a "club" secretary and collecting orders together but remember that he is the sole buyer officially.  He is then simply reselling as a private individual at cost which does not have to attract VAT.  It works nicely as a club but it cannot have any official connection or the VAT issue would raise it's ugly head.
